Re: Who Should Oscar Face?
Personally, I would like to see him fight the winner of Cotto/Margarito. It would be the most hypeable match. And a great way to keep Oscar fighting the best.
Here's how I think he would fair against everyone:
vs Cotto: Cotto by stoppage. Cotto would bust him up inside and be too strong/crafty. If he was able to hit Mosley at will, he would do a number on De La Hoya. Cotto can fight backing up and coming forward, southpaw and right-handed, he's just all around SCARY.
vs Margarito: This would be a better match up for Oscar than Cotto IMO. Margarito would take what Oscar has to give but return fire even worse. Margarito only knows how to go forward, but Oscar is a good counter-puncher so the style would mix very well. I wouldn't be surprised if Oscar won here though. But if Margarito gets past Cotto, I would pick him over De La Hoya.
vs Wright: Usually, I would pick Wright to box circles around De La Hoya, but due to his aging and inactivity, I see Oscar winning now. Give Winky a tune-up fight, then he wins a lopsided UD.
vs Shane Mosley: I don't think they should fight again. Shane can still compete with the best in his division. At this stage in their careers, I don't see much changing. Mosley UD.
vs Paul Williams: Williams is too active and too long for De La Hoya. Williams would make Oscar look bad.
vs Sergio Mora: Take this off the list! No one would want to see this! Oscar by UD though.
vs Steve Forbes: Just when I thought Mora would be the worst idea here, Forbes would be even worse.
At this stage in his career, Oscar would lose most of these fights. A prime De La Hoya, would be a different story. If he want's that final victory against a name, he should fight Pacquiao or Hatton. Everyone would think those fights as complete BS, but Oscar did fight Forbes so anything is possible with him.

Re: Who Should Oscar Face?
I can't believe I'm saying this, but I voted for Mora.
OK, here me out. It would be a very fast turn around for either Cotto or Margo to fight a potential war in July, then turn around and face Oscar two months later. I know I can be done, but it could be a little soon. The winner of that fight is probably going to need a little time off after that battle. Because of this, I'm ruling out Cotto and Tony. I would love to see him fight these guys at another time, but they aren't my choice for his Sept 20 date.
That leaves Mosley and Mora. Really, I could go for either fight, but we've seen younger, better versions of Oscar and Shane clash. I would be chance for Oscar to redeem himself and avenge the controversial decision. This fight would certainly make sense and I nearly voted for it.
Mora, on the other hand, is a legit belt holder at 154. None of the other belt holders have the name recognition or could sell as many tickets as Mora. It's a great story. Contender champion to world champion to fighting this generation's more popular boxers. It's great drama. I'm loathed to say it, but because he is stylistically awkward and a bigger man, he presents a bit of a challenge, at least more than Forbes. Mora could do some things to make the fight interesting. Rematching Mosley would be more dangerous and if Oscar wants to go out with a belt around his waste, Mora is the ticket. Also if Oscar fight Mosley and looses, it probably takes away from a potential mega fight with Cotto next year - hmmm, maybe on Cinco de Mayo?
Again, I can't believe I'm writing this, but Mora would be a very smart choice to fill the Sept 20 date. He's available, he's recognizable, and you can sell this fight big. Then Oscar can look to the Cotto/Tony winner if he wants one last megafight.
